So...  Trace + Chaney are apparently courting.  At this point, we seriously need some concrete dates for their relationship.  Right now, we’ve got zilch...  or, do we?  After a thorough review of all relevant Instagrams, I think I’ve got enough for a few data–based estimates.  Here is my best guess for their First Meeting, Pre–Courtship, and Courtship dates—
Tumblr media
First Meeting
Trace + Chaney met 8 Months Ago, as of September 2019.  (This was reported by In Touch, when they announced that Trace + Chaney were “officially dating.”  It was also confirmed by Trace when, on September 11, 2019, he posted on IG:  “It has been a great 8 Months getting to know this beautiful girl [Chaney].”)
We also know that Trace met Chaney during a ski trip, because Kelly Jo Bates told us so in her ‘Happy Birthday’ IG Post to Chaney.  Kelly wrote, in that Post:  “I’m grateful God let our paths cross on that cold, winters wonderland ski trip.” A few days later, In Touch added that the trip in question was to Colorado.  On Instagram, Trace, Lawson, and Kelly Jo all posted about the trip.  Kelly actually tagged Chaney’s older sister, Chelsea Kahle, in her Post, thanked Chelsea “for taking pictures for us,” and said:  “It was a joy to meet your sweet family!”  
After some sleuthing, here’s what I was able to dig up about the exact timing of the Bates and Kahle trips—
The Bateses were in Colorado on (and around) January 10, 2019.  (They recorded the January 10, 2019 Live Chat at what appeared to be a cabin or ski house, and they mentioned that they were in Colorado, skiing.)
Bethany Kahle got engaged to her now–husband, Trenton, on January 9, 2019 in Granby, Colorado, a ski area.  (Duggar Data found this fact on the couple’s public wedding website.  Trace + Chaney attended the wedding, as well.  They both posted photos from the wedding on IG.)
Based on this Post on Chelsea Kahle’s Instagram, the Kahles might have left Colorado on January 13, 2019 (May 21, 2019 — 128 Days).  (Note—Chelsea’s IG is public.)
Since they met “8 Months Ago” in September 2019, Trace + Chaney must have met in January 2019.  While we don’t know the exact date, my sleuthing shows that the Bateses were in Colorado on (and around) January 10, while the Kahles were likely in Colorado on (and around) January 9–13.  Put differently:  We have evidence placing both families in Colorado on January 10, 2019.  That is what I will use for Trace + Chaney’s Estimated First Meeting date.
Tumblr media
Pre–Courtship
Pre–Courtship is sort of a nebulous concept, but it’s clear that Trace + Chaney were ‘special friends’ by the Bates Family’s 2019 “I Love You Day” party.  (See Bringing Up Bates (9–19–19), “A Very Medieval ‘I Love You’ Day.”)  If Instagram can be trusted, that party occurred on (or about) February 17, 2019.  Since we know they were ‘special friends’ by then, that’ll be Trace + Chaney’s Estimated Pre–Courtship start date, until and unless better data becomes available.
Note that, thus far, your typical Bates announces a pre–courtship after about 6 Months (196 Days).  If the September 11, 2019 In Touch article was intended to announce Trace + Chaney’s pre–courtship (as opposed to courtship), it fits well with a February start date.  (September 11, 2019 — 196 Days = February 27.)
Tumblr media
Courtship
This is the tricky one...  According to Kelly Bates, Trace + Chaney are courting.  She said so on the September 19, 2019 Bates Family Live Chat...  Specifically, she said:  “Trace just started courting.”  But what does that mean?  And, does that mean the In Touch article was actually a courtship announcement?  It’s all very confusing.  Let’s see if the data helps...
So far, the typical Bates waits 47 Days to publicly announce a courtship.  If the In Touch article was actually a courtship announcement, then perhaps Trace + Chaney’s courtship began 47 Days Prior, on July 26, 2019.
Alternately, the Predictor assumes a Bates–typical length pre–courtship before the ‘courtposal.’  Currently, it’s Bates–typical to pre–court for 301 Days.  If they started pre–courting on February 17, 2019, that data suggests the ‘courtposal’ would occur December 15, 2019.
... and that won’t work.  Apparently, they’re already courting!  So, maybe their relationship is moving at a faster pace (Average – 1 SD).  If that’s the case, the pre–courtship would only last 118 Days.  If it began on February 17, 2019, the courtposal might’ve occurred on June 15, 2019.
Honestly, it’s kind of creepy...  That’s actually the date I suspected, after taking a hard look at all the Instagram evidence.  Chaney posted a really suspicious–looking photo of her and Trace and a romantic sunset on June 15, 2019.  (Yes, that exact date.  Wild, right?)  Photos of Trace + Chaney really increased after that, too, as did instances where they were ‘confirmed’ as a couple.  Here’s an overly–detailed timeline—
6–15–19   Chaney posts a photo of her and Trace enjoying a sunset.  It’s met with many unsolicited “congratulations” by commenters assuming a courtposal.  Also, several Bateses commented on it.  Trace said:  “That’s one sunset I’ll never forget.”  Alyssa said:  “Y’all are perfect!”  Plus, Kelly Jo, Whitney, Katie, and Josie all commented approvingly.
6–16–19   Trace posts on IG that his “Sundays are brighter with [Chaney] in them.”
6–25–19   The Bates Family IG posts photos from a recent trip to Waco, TX.  Kelly gives a ‘photo credit’ to Chelsea Kahle, clearly indicating that the Bateses saw the Kahles during that trip.  (The Kahles live in Texas.)
7–2–19   A photo of Trace + Chaney at Chuck E. Cheese appears on the Bates Family IG.
7–6–19   Whitney posts a photo of Trace + Chaney at the Bates Family’s July 4th party in South Carolina.
7–11–19   Bates Sister Boutique refers to Chaney as “Trace’s girlfriend,” when asked (via comment) if she is dating a Bates.
8–10–19   Trace accompanies Chaney to her sister’s wedding in Texas. 
8–18–19   The Bates Family IG posts a photo of Trace + Chaney coupled up at yet another wedding (Abby Paine’s).
9–9–19   Kelly Jo wishes Chaney a ‘happy birthday’ on IG, saying:  “I’m looking forward to many more visits with you....  I’m sure Trace seconds that idea!”
9–11–19    In Touch exclusively reveals that Trace + Chaney are “dating.”
9–11–19   Trace posts a photo of him and Chaney on IG, and says:  “It’s been a great eight months getting to know this beautiful girl.”
9–19–19   On the Bates Family Live Chat, Kelly says:  “Trace just started courting.”  (Trace wasn’t present on the Live Chat.)  She didn’t say when the courtship began, or give any other details.
TL;DR
For now, Duggar Data will use the following dates for Trace + Chaney...
First Meeting   January 10, 2019
Pre–Courting   February 17, 2019
Courting   June 15, 2019
All of these are estimates, especially the courtposal date.  We really don’t have much data to go on for these two!  I’m hoping more comes out on this season of Bringing Up Bates.

Michael After Midnight: Duke Nukem Forever
Tumblr media
I like to kick off each new year with a truly magical review. Remember when I kicked off 2018 by reviewing a Jesus porno? Let’s be real, I peaked with that one. I’m not even gonna try to top it. What I will do, however, is talk about something I’ve wanted to discuss for a long time: Duke Nukem Forever.
This game almost needs no introduction; its stay in development hell and its tumultuous development is the stuff of legends, second only to Half-Life 3 in infamy among gaming vaporware. And it somehow managed to stay in infamy because despite releasing, UNLIKE Half-Life 3, most people who bought it really wished that it hadn’t. It turned out Duke was in the oven a bit too long, and the game we got was a mediocre shooter that was already out of date by several years when it finally released, not helped by its potshots at better series and use of extremely dated memes (Leeroy Jenkins? Really?). 
Thankfully, I was divorced from this decade-spanning drama, being barely aware of the game until a few years back. Being a fan of Duke as a character - he is a loving spoof of the kind of action heroes I enjoy after all - and curious about the game after reading the fascinating history behind its development, I ended up playing it and… I thought it was okay. Yeah, I was expecting a lot more from this game in either direction, but it ended up being a rather middling, decent experience.
So let’s talk about what’s unironically good first: the interactivity. There are a LOT of little things Duke can interact with around the world, from a whiteboard you can doodle on to a functional pinball machine. None of this is groundbreaking by any means, but there is a certain childish thrill from picking up a turd from a toilet and flinging it around or from smacking some alien wall titties. There’s even an enjoyable dream sequence where Dukeis at a club that has tons of interactive elements in it! The fact that a lot of these interactive elements can lead to increases in Duke’s health is an added incentive to spend time doing them.
I actually enjoy some of the level design in the first half of the game, in particular the segments where Duke is shrunk down. I don’t know about you guys, but there’s something I really find charming about hopping over fryers and climbing through conveniently placed holes in the walls of a shitty fast food joint. It’s the sort of stuff I imagine when I’m bored at work. If the whole game had been as creative and fun as these parts and had expanded on the interactivity more, I think this would have been worth the wait a bit more… but unfortunately there’s more to this game.
After the first couple of segments, the level design plummets. The portions where Duke has to drive through the desert are especially jarring as they are incredibly barren with little to do or discover. This is then taken to the opposite extreme when you get to the final area, the dam, which is downright labyrinthine at parts and absurdly difficult. You will likely not die any place more than in this level due to the ridiculous number of enemies they cram into the tight corridors and underwater sections. It makes you wonder if this area was made so difficult to hide how short the game is - things wrap up after the dam level ends, with one ridiculously easy final boss left once you escape.
Then again, you may be thanking your lucky stars this game is mercifully short, because Duke and the world he inhabits are pretty intolerable. The entire world has become a monument to Duke’s ego, with just about everything revolving around him. Duke is like a Mary Sue escapist fantasy - a huge macho man who kicks ass, takes names, gets blowjobs from twins and his genderbent counterpart (apparently it is Bombshell’s model behind the glory hole in Duke’s dream, so he can literally go fuck himself), and is adored by literally everyone. And yeah, Duke was always kind of like this… but somewhere along the game’s journey somebody forgot that the tongue of the writers is supposed to be firmly planted in their cheek. The issue here is that the game is taking everything about Duke DEAD SERIOUS. We’re supposed to see Duke as the supreme god-tier badass who makes Master Chief and Gordon Freeman look like pussies, but it’s hard to buy into that idea when we are only told this while playing as him is just an unfun chore.
And maybe this would be better if they had polished up Duke’s character a bit, but he’s really inconsistent. Jon St. John is still absolutely fantastic with the voice and the delivery, there’s no denying that, but he unfortunately is portraying a really lame iteration of this beloved character. I think the point where I lost faith in this Duke is when, after finding the blowjob twins trapped in alien cocoons and begging him for help, Duke’s response is to just tell them they’re fucked. This is in stark contrast to him going apeshit when the aliens stole his babes, and is yet another sign the writers just didn’t GET Duke. Duke is an overly-macho chauvinist, yes, but he DOES care about babes. He’s more Johnny Bravo, less conservative pro-life blogger. Here though? This is just an uncharacteristically misogynistic response, and it is never commented on again. It’s just so jarring and bad that it kind of hampered my enjoyment of the game.
Still though, there is something halfway charming buried under the garbage. There are flashes of fun here and there that show promise of a better game, but they are always ultimately crushed. I feel if this game had come out in a more timely fashion with the innovations it does have, it would be considered revolutionary, but alas, we don’t live in that world. Half-Life 2, Halo, BioShock, and countless other franchises came and redefined what an FPS could be while this game was floundering between studios, leaving it so that when this game finally dropped, there really wasn’t anything special about it save for its protagonist, who himself felt like a relic from a bygone age who had become in earnest the very thing he once parodied so effectively. 
It’s hard to really recommend this game; even among first-person shooters, which tend to age like milk, this game has aged very poorly. If you’re curious about it like I was, well, there are worse things to pull out of a bargain bin; the game is dirt cheap on most consoles. Generally speaking though I’d say just get the equally cheap yet infinitely better Duke Nukem 3D; it’s frankly amazing how much better that game has aged despite it being a game released in the wake of the original Doom. 
What the future holds for Duke is rather unclear; at the end of this game he says he’s gonna run for President, but I dunno, the idea of an overly macho, violent, misogynistic celebrity becoming president is pretty far-fetched, riiiiiiiiiiight? Let’s not end this on a depressing note that reminds us of the bottomless stupidity of American politics, though. Let me tell you the one genuinely good thing this game brought to the world:
I brought the cover insert of the game to be signed by Jon St. John at a convention, and when I presented it he said in a tone that clearly was used to being dunked on for the game “Be honest, what did you think of the game?” And I told him, “There were a couple parts I didn’t like, but overall I thought it was fun,” and the guy just lit up. It just made me really happy that someone liking this dumb game brightened his day like that, and honestly? It wasn't a lie. I did have fun with this game, despite its flaws, and if it let me brighten the game’s star’s day by saying I enjoyed it even a little, I’m glad it exists.
